摘要
This paper shows that the ratio of compressional- and shear-wave velocities (V-P and V-S, respectively) better characterize the near-surface than individual velocity models. In a proof-of-concept experiment, vertical and tangential data were acquired along a 23 m, 2D profile containing two well-documented utility pipes with 0.76 m diameter and 1.5 m burial depth. First arrivals of both datasets were inverted using a regularized tomography algorithm. The inverted V-P and V-S images, which fit their respective datasets within the noise level, were smooth with no clear anomalous structure at the pipe locations. In the V-P/V-S ratio image, however, the pipe locations appear as zones with high ratio values (> 1.8). A nearby zone of low (< 1.5) V-P/V-S ratio was interpreted as a backfilled void. These results suggested that carefully conducted P- and S-refraction tomography can provide quick and effective near-surface reconnaissance.
